Teenage girl autistic seen barefoot in creek at park, Huntington WV
Officers responded to St. Cloud Commons Park after a report of a teenage girl with autism seen barefoot entering and exiting a creek. She was described as about 5 feet 3 inches tall, weighing between 180 and 200 pounds, with her hair pulled up with chopsticks, wearing a blue sweatshirt and dark blue jeans.
